# Pointsgrove loyalty-points ledger — environment config
# Welcome aboard. This file configures the ledger service that records every
# earn and burn event for the Marlow rewards program. DB settings point at the
# staging replica; do not swap in production values without sign-off from the
# ledger team. Batch reconciliation runs nightly and needs write access to the
# settlement queue, which is gated by a service secret. Per convention, that
# secret is declared on the line directly below this comment block.

sealed setting: ARCHIVE_KEY3=8d0

Subject: Partner SFTP drop — new owner

Hi,

As you review the pending changes to the Harborline ingest scripts, note that ownership of the partner SFTP drop is changing at the end of the month. This includes key rotation, the nightly pull job, and the quarantine folder for malformed files. Review comments on the retry logic should still go through the normal PR flow, but questions about drop-folder conventions or partner onboarding now go to the new owner. The incoming owner is listed below.

signatory, tagaf-bahaf: Praael Fenmir Rusok

Facilities Ticket — Cleaning Crew Access, Brindle Annex

For new starters handling evening lock-up: the Sorano Cleaning crew arrives nightly at 21:30 via the annex side door. Check their rota sheet, note arrival in the log, and ensure the storeroom is relocked afterward. To let them through the side door, enter the access code below.

badge for yaweg-hafog: bdg-GX-6

Hey Tobin — wrapping up the rounding fix in Marrowpay's FX converter. Root cause: we rounded per-hop instead of at settlement, so chained conversions drifted by a cent or two. Fixed in v1.9; tests cover the nasty three-currency cases. Future folks: don't touch the rounding mode without rerunning the ledger suite. The converter now runs with these settings.

deployment values, hahag-kahap:
[quenwyn]
team = zormir
access_code = ac_b7f4f2
owner = queneth.casvan
host = quenwyn.zemvarcorp.example
port = 9090
peer = oliir.olvarqdata.corp
salt = 3d732bf1
pin = 3832